Geographic Distribution: Psilocyben mushrooms thrive in temperate, tropical regions, favoring North/South America, Europe, Asia

Psilocybin mushrooms, commonly known as "magic mushrooms," exhibit a fascinating geographic distribution that spans both temperate and tropical regions across the globe. These fungi are particularly prevalent in areas with specific climatic and environmental conditions that support their growth. North America is one of the primary regions where psilocybin mushrooms thrive, especially in the Pacific Northwest of the United States and parts of Mexico. The temperate climate, coupled with abundant rainfall and rich, organic soil, creates an ideal habitat for species like *Psilocybe cubensis* and *Psilocybe cyanescens*. In the U.S., states such as Oregon, Washington, and California are well-known for their native psilocybin mushroom populations, often found in wooded areas with decaying wood matter.

South America is another significant hotspot for psilocybin mushrooms, particularly in countries like Brazil, Colombia, and Ecuador. The Amazon rainforest, with its tropical climate and high humidity, provides a perfect environment for species such as *Psilocybe mexicana* and *Psilocybe semilanceata*. Indigenous cultures in this region have historically used these mushrooms in spiritual and medicinal practices, further highlighting their prevalence. The combination of lush vegetation, consistent rainfall, and warm temperatures makes South America a prime location for psilocybin mushroom growth.

Europe also hosts a variety of psilocybin mushroom species, particularly in temperate regions with mild, damp climates. Countries like the United Kingdom, the Netherlands, and parts of Eastern Europe are known for species such as *Psilocybe semilanceata*, often referred to as the "liberty cap." These mushrooms are commonly found in grassy fields, especially those enriched with manure or near livestock. The cooler, moist conditions of European autumns create an optimal window for their growth, making them a seasonal find in these areas.

Asia contributes to the global distribution of psilocybin mushrooms, with species found in countries such as Japan, Thailand, and India. In Japan, *Psilocybe serrulata* grows in subtropical regions, while Thailand’s tropical climate supports species like *Psilocybe cubensis*. India, with its diverse ecosystems, hosts mushrooms in both temperate Himalayan regions and tropical southern areas. The variability in Asian climates allows for a wide range of psilocybin mushroom species to flourish, often in forested areas with high humidity and organic debris.

Overall, the geographic distribution of psilocybin mushrooms is closely tied to regions with temperate or tropical climates, rich organic matter, and consistent moisture. Their presence in North/South America, Europe, and Asia underscores their adaptability to diverse environments, though they are most abundant in areas with specific ecological conditions. Seasonal Growth: Typically grow in late summer to early fall, depending on climate and moisture

Psilocybin mushrooms, often referred to as "magic mushrooms," exhibit a distinct seasonal growth pattern that is heavily influenced by environmental factors, particularly climate and moisture. Seasonal Growth: Typically, these fungi thrive in late summer to early fall, though this timing can vary based on geographic location and local weather conditions. During these months, the combination of warmer soil temperatures and increased humidity creates an ideal environment for their growth. The mycelium, the vegetative part of the fungus, remains dormant during colder months and springs to life as temperatures rise, initiating the fruiting process that produces the mushrooms.

The late summer to early fall period is crucial because it often follows a season of rainfall, which saturates the soil and provides the necessary moisture for mushroom development. Psilocybin mushrooms are particularly fond of woodland environments, where they grow in symbiotic relationships with trees and decaying organic matter. In regions with temperate climates, such as the Pacific Northwest in the United States or parts of Europe, this seasonal window aligns perfectly with the natural decay of leaves and wood, offering abundant nutrients for the fungi. However, in drier or more tropical climates, growth may occur during rainy seasons, which can happen at different times of the year.

Moisture is a non-negotiable requirement for psilocybin mushroom growth, making humid environments essential. After a period of rain, the soil retains enough water to support the rapid growth of these mushrooms, often over just a few days. Foragers often note that the best time to search for them is a few days after a significant rainfall during the late summer or early fall. This timing ensures that the mushrooms have had enough moisture to fruit but have not yet been exposed to prolonged dry conditions, which can cause them to deteriorate quickly.

Climate plays a pivotal role in determining the exact timing of their growth. In cooler regions, the season may be slightly delayed, pushing growth into October or even November, while in warmer areas, it might begin as early as late July. Altitude also influences growth patterns, with higher elevations experiencing cooler temperatures that can delay the fruiting process. For instance, mountainous areas may see psilocybin mushrooms emerge later in the season compared to lowland forests.

Habitat Preferences: Found in grassy fields, forests, dung, wood chips, and decaying organic matter

Psilocybin mushrooms, often referred to as "magic mushrooms," exhibit specific habitat preferences that are crucial for their growth. One of the most common environments where these fungi thrive is grassy fields. These mushrooms often appear in pastures, lawns, and meadows, particularly after periods of rainfall. The grass provides a suitable substrate for their mycelium to grow, and the open environment allows for adequate sunlight and moisture. However, it’s important to note that psilocybin mushrooms in grassy areas are often associated with the presence of animal dung, which serves as a nutrient-rich medium for their development.

Forests are another primary habitat for psilocybin mushrooms, especially deciduous and coniferous woodlands. These fungi favor the rich, organic soil found under leaf litter and decaying wood. The shaded, humid conditions of forests create an ideal microclimate for their growth. Species like *Psilocybe cubensis* and *Psilocybe semilanceata* are frequently found in wooded areas, often near trails or clearings where moisture levels are consistently high. The symbiotic relationship between the mushrooms and the forest ecosystem highlights their preference for environments with abundant organic matter.

Dung is a particularly significant habitat for certain psilocybin mushroom species, such as *Psilocybe cubensis*. These mushrooms are coprophilous, meaning they grow on animal feces, particularly from grazing animals like cows and horses. The dung provides essential nutrients, including nitrogen, which accelerates the mushroom’s growth. Foragers often find these mushrooms in pastures or fields where livestock are present, especially after rainy periods when the dung is moist and conducive to fungal development.

Wood chips and decaying organic matter are also favored habitats for psilocybin mushrooms. Mulched areas, compost piles, and gardens with rotting wood provide the perfect substrate for their mycelium to colonize. The decomposition process releases nutrients that support mushroom growth, while the moisture retained in wood chips creates a stable environment. Species like *Psilocybe cyanescens* are commonly found in mulched landscaping areas, particularly in regions with mild, temperate climates.

Soil Conditions: Require rich, nitrogen-dense soil, often near livestock or fertile, well-drained environments

Psilocybin mushrooms, often referred to as "magic mushrooms," thrive in specific soil conditions that are rich in organic matter and nitrogen. These fungi are particularly fond of environments where the soil is fertile and well-drained, ensuring that excess water does not accumulate and cause root rot. The presence of nitrogen is crucial, as it supports the rapid growth and development of the mycelium, the vegetative part of the fungus. Such soil conditions are commonly found in areas where organic material decomposes naturally, providing a steady supply of nutrients.

One of the most common locations for psilocybin mushrooms is near livestock, such as cows or sheep. Livestock manure is a significant source of nitrogen and other essential nutrients, creating an ideal environment for these mushrooms to grow. The manure enriches the soil, making it more fertile and conducive to fungal growth. Additionally, the trampling action of livestock helps to mix the organic matter into the soil, further enhancing its structure and nutrient availability. This symbiotic relationship between livestock and psilocybin mushrooms highlights the importance of nitrogen-dense soil in their life cycle.

Fertile, well-drained environments are another key factor in the growth of psilocybin mushrooms. These fungi prefer soils that retain enough moisture to support growth but are not waterlogged. Well-drained soils prevent the accumulation of excess water, which can lead to anaerobic conditions detrimental to fungal health. Such environments are often found in meadows, pastures, and woodland edges where the soil is naturally aerated and rich in organic matter. The combination of fertility and proper drainage ensures that the mushrooms have access to both nutrients and oxygen, which are essential for their development.

Environmental Factors: Need high humidity, moderate temperatures, and indirect sunlight for optimal growth

Psilocybin mushrooms, often referred to as "magic mushrooms," thrive in specific environmental conditions that mimic their natural habitats. High humidity is a critical factor for their growth, as these fungi require moisture to develop properly. In the wild, they are commonly found in damp environments such as forests, meadows, and grasslands, where humidity levels are consistently elevated. For cultivation, maintaining humidity between 80-95% is essential. This can be achieved by using humidifiers, misting the growing area regularly, or placing a tray of water near the mushrooms to ensure the air remains saturated with moisture. Without adequate humidity, the mushrooms may dry out, stunting their growth or preventing fruiting altogether.

Moderate temperatures are another key environmental factor for psilocybin mushroom growth. These fungi prefer temperatures ranging from 70°F to 75°F (21°C to 24°C), which closely mirrors the conditions of their natural habitats during their growing seasons. Temperatures outside this range can hinder growth or lead to contamination. For instance, cooler temperatures slow down development, while excessive heat can kill the mycelium. Cultivators often use heating pads or thermostats to maintain a stable temperature within this optimal range, ensuring the mushrooms grow efficiently and healthily.

Indirect sunlight is vital for psilocybin mushrooms, as they do not require direct exposure to intense light but still benefit from a light source to trigger fruiting. In nature, these mushrooms often grow under the canopy of trees or in shaded areas where sunlight is filtered. For indoor cultivation, growers typically use fluorescent or LED lights placed a few feet above the growing substrate, providing enough light to stimulate fruiting without causing stress. Direct sunlight should be avoided, as it can dry out the mushrooms and damage their delicate structures.
